Hearing Checks

A hearing test takes place in a sound-proofed room or cubicle. You will take a seat, put on some headphones and listen. 

The hearing care professional will start playing sounds that start at a bass tone and work up to treble tone. They will ask you to push a button when you hear each sound. 

Each time you press the button, the hearing care professional will plot your results which will enable them ascertain your hearing range. 

Once your type and degree of hearing loss has been determined, your hearing care professional will be able to decide how much amplification you will need. They may then show you a range of instruments appropriate for your individual hearing loss and together you can decide what is right for you.
